Summarize how does the flight of duncan’s sons play into macbeth’s hands?
Yuki888 [10]
Answer:

By running away, the princes make themselves look guilty. It almost looks like they killed their own father to get the thrown and they thought they would be caught so they ran away in secret. What’s even worse was the fact that they went to two separate country’s (split up) which seems even more guilty to the simple mans mind
